FrameMaker 8 won't import SVG graphics correctly

I am working on a personal DITA project in FrameMaker 8 with 
DITA-FMx, the more highly functional successor to the Adobe DITA plug-in.

I created an SVG graphic graphic consisting of a screen capture of a 
dialogue as a PNG graphic, a few straight lines, and some text in 
Inkscape and saved as Inkscape SVG.
When imported into a DITA <image> element for the first time, using 
the excellent DITA-FMx plug-in with FM8, the PNG pixmap appeared plus 
the rules, but much thicker than when drawn, but no text appeared.

The SVG graphic displays correctly in the Adobe SVG Viewer and 
Batik,  and, when saved as PDF from Inkscape, also displays in 
Acrobat.  However, Firefox displayed it the same as in FM8, that is, 
pixmap and rules but no text.  Serna and oXygen both popped an alert 
that Adobe SVG Viewer 3.03 was not supported and suggested reverting 
to v. 3.02.

Trying again in FM8, this time only the top and left sides of the 
pixmap appeared as a sort of upside down L, plus lines but no text.

Saving the SVG graphic from Inkscape to standard SVG and running all 
the above tests produced the same result.  Importing into FM8 
unstructured documents produced the same result.

It's crucial to get FM8 importing SVG graphics correctly as you 
cannot add leader lines to an FM graphic to be saved in an XML file 
-- and there are a LOT of graphics with callouts.

Does anybody have a workaround for this problem?
